Bridlington Woman Doubles Walking Challenge To ‘Go The Extra Mile’ For Saint Catherine’s

A Bridlington woman who walked 1,500 miles to raise funds for Saint Catherine's is now aiming to complete an incredible 3,000-mile challenge.

Louise Brown has been walking every day since April to raise money in memory of dear friend Ray Francis MBE, who passed away at the hospice in December.

Ray was a veteran serving his country for 23 years in the army, even getting mentioned in dispatches. He then became a prison officer, and a prisoner nominated him for his MBE for services to charity.

He helped many charities including the Special Olympics, Prison Service Games, Riding for the Disabled and Parkinson’s UK.

Louise’s initial plan was to walk 100 miles a week for 15 weeks, as Ray was in Saint Catherine’s for 15 nights. The distance of 1,500 is also significant as it costs around £1,500 for provide 24 hours of care for a patient.

However, Louise has now extended her challenge to 3,000 miles, saying: “Saint Catherine’s go the extra mile, so I will too.”

She added:

“At the moment, if I walk another 888.4 miles, I will have covered the distance to the Earth’s core. I have found the walking easier than I thought and wanted to make it more of a challenge.”

So far, Louise has raised over £4,000 and says she is ‘shocked and amazed’ at the amount.

She added:

“The support has been brilliant, particularly from the Bridlington Veteran’s Group and the team at Saint Catherine’s.”

Louise has been accessing support from the Wellbeing the team at the hospice and says she is incredibly grateful for everything they do.

She was also thrilled to receive a letter from Prince William, wishing her well in her challenge and acknowledging the amazing work and wonderful staff at Saint Catherine’s.
